Falls Church, VA: Stripes Publishers, 1990. 1st Edition. Hardcover. Very Good-/No Jacket. Surfaces of the plain black boards show minor wear with a few light scratches. Very light warp to front board. Inscribed on page 56 by June Courtean (recipient of the 1989 Naismith Award for Women's Official of the Year). Pages are clean and binding is tight. First edition, first printing, 1990. Features several articles and essays on the history, philosophy, and practice of refereeing basketball; detailed discussion of basketball rules, including the illegal defense, a detailed catalog of all the basketball camps in the US, and the complete roster of referees for the year 1989-1990 in the NBA, CBA, USBL, and for each of the Division I conferences in the NCAA (including both Men's and Women's). 122 pages.
